LUCKNOW: The Uttar Pradesh Power Corporation Limited (UPPCL) has imposed a 10 per cent fuel and power purchase adjustment surcharge (FPPAS) on electricity consumers for June.The surcharge, based on fuel and power purchase costs incurred in March 2026, is expected to generate around Rs 1,610.57 crore from consumers across the state.According to a UPPCL order issued on Friday, the calculated FPPAS for March 2026 worked out to 20.61 per cent. However, under the Uttar Pradesh Electricity Regulatory Commission’s (UPERC) regulations, the surcharge recoverable in a month is capped at 10 per cent, which will be levied through June electricity bills. The order also indicates that the remaining unrecovered amount may be adjusted in subsequent months.Reacting sharply, Uttar Pradesh Rajya Vidyut Upbhokta Parishad Chairman and State Advisory Committee member Avadhesh Kumar Verma alleged that consumers were being unfairly burdened at a time when they were already facing inflation, rising fuel prices and power supply issues. He claimed that nearly Rs 1,400 crore in old dues of the past two years had been included in the surcharge calculations, inflating the amount to be recovered from consumers.Verma further alleged that while the UPERC had approved a power purchase cost of Rs 4.94 per unit in its tariff order, UPPCL showed an actual purchase cost of about Rs 5.86 per unit for March 2026, resulting in an additional burden of around Rs 1,610 crore on consumers.He demanded an independent investigation into the circumstances under which expensive power was procured and questioned purchases from private power producers at higher rates.The consumer body has also sought UPERC for amendments in the fuel surcharge regulations and urged immediate halt on further recoveries until a detailed investigation is completed.
